## Data Stores: DocSniff Linter

DocSniff (our docs linter) keeps its rule results in two places: a lightweight cache on each CI runner, and a central results store we use for release-gate reporting. For cutting a release, only the central store matters—it holds pass/fail history per page and the suppression list. When you need to pull the gate report manually, connect to the results database with the string below.

replica DSN, kajep-yahag: mssql://praok_svc:iF@db-8d68.plorvaio.local:5432/eliion

Before cutting over traffic, confirm the Dunmoor load balancer is probing the deep health endpoint, not the shallow liveness route — the shallow route returns healthy even when the Kestrelbay database pool is exhausted, which caused last quarter's silent outage. Verify probe interval is 10 seconds with a three-failure threshold, and that draining nodes fail probes before connections are severed. Watch the target-group dashboard for at least one full rotation. Once all targets show healthy, note the deployment token immediately below.

pipeline stamp: htk3_cc5

Markdown pipeline runbook — Ferngate renderer. If preview output is blank, check the Slateroot sanitizer stage first; it silently drops documents over 2MB. Restart the worker pool, then replay the failed queue from the Mirrowell dashboard. Do not clear the cache unless rendering errors persist after replay. Escalate to the Ferngate on-call if replay loops twice. Verification requires the trace token from the last successful replay, shown below.

trace token, yahif-kagep: htk31_bd0cc6b1d7ab4f7094c586a5de900e0

Memo to Branch Managers — Hiring Freeze, Logistics Division. Quick heads-up: effective Monday, all open roles in the Tarnwell logistics division are frozen. Existing offers stand; anything without a signed offer is on hold. Backfills need sign-off from Dana Croft. This isn't a company-wide thing, so please don't spook your teams. The reasoning connects to the direction sketched out below.

confidential, kagup-bafog: Fraaxax Group is in early talks to buy Soroxox Group for about $343.8 million. The Olidor launch date is June 14, and nothing goes to the press before then. Legal wants the Aldmirek Logistics term sheet signed before July 23.